> The best 727 "version" was the Hemi 727. From the looks of the 48RE
> internals, you can compare it to the Hemi 727. Better planateries,
> better direct drum design, better/more clutches, etc.
>
> The 46RE uses 4-pinion planetaries, the 47RE uses 5-pinion
> planteries...but
> the 48RE uses 6-pinion. More pinions = better/higher torque capacity.
> (Unlike some other transmission builders who claim that the 3-pinion is
> better - won't mention names, but they know who they are.)
